Congratulations to our robotics team for winning the state championship for the second year in a row! On Saturday, the FTC Robotics State Championship was held at Denham Springs High School and featured the 23 best teams throughout the state. Our team (19864 Pride Robotics) went an impressive 6-0 during the day's qualifying matches and an even more impressive 4-0 in the concluding playoffs. In addition to competitive matches, teams write an engineering portfolio and complete a series of interviews with judges, and for this Pride Robotics also won the Control Award for their excellent use of sensors and software. 

The team will represent the Louisiana region in April at the World Championships in Houston. A special shoutout to head coach Matt Owen and assistant coach Adrian O'Keefe for their leadership and commitment to supporting our students.
